The place of La Candelaria is inside the municipality of Huimanguillo (in the State of Tabasco). There are 359 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#108 of the ranking. La Candelaria is at 591 meters of altitude.
Data: In La Candelaria, 43% of the inhabitants are catholic and 38% of the dwellings are equipped with a washing machine. At the bottom of this page you will find more information.
Do you want to locate the town of La Candelaria? You can find it at 61.7 kilometers, in direction Northwest, from the town of Huimanguillo, which has the largest population within the municipality. #2 The population of La Candelaria (Tabasco) is 359 inhabitants
Year | Female Inhabitants | Male inhabitants | Total population |
---|---|---|---|
2020 | 186 | 173 | 359 |
2010 | 192 | 199 | 391 |
2005 | 181 | 166 | 347 |
2020 | 2010 | |
---|---|---|
Fertility rate (children per woman): | 3.17 | 4.52 |
Population coming from outside the State of Tabasco: | 25.07% | 25.58% |
Illiterate population: | 9.19% | 8.44% |
Illiterate population (men): | 3.34% | 4.52% |
Illiterate population (women): | 5.85% | 12.50% |
Schooling level: | 6.09 | 4.87 |
Schooling level (men): | 6.29 | 4.95 |
Schooling level (women): | 5.91 | 4.79 |
2020 | 2010 | |
---|---|---|
Percentage of indigenous population: | 14.21% | 23.02% |
Percentage speaking an indigenous language: | 4.74% | 6.91% |
Percentage who speak an indigenous language and do not speak Spanish: | 0.00% | 0.00% |

2020 | 2010 | |
---|---|---|
Employed population over 12 years: | 32.03% | 24.04% |
Employed population over 12 years (men): | 52.02% | 46.23% |
Employed population over 12 years (women): | 13.44% | 1.04% |
Number of inhabited private dwellings: | 81 | 83 |
Homes with electricity: | 100.00% | 97.30% |
Housing with piped water: | 98.77% | 25.68% |
Dwellings with toilet or sanitary facilities: | 96.30% | 83.78% |
Dwellings with radio: | 29.63% | 33.78% |
Housing with television: | 53.09% | 68.92% |
Housing with refrigerator: | 64.20% | 43.24% |
Housing with washing machine: | 38.27% | 21.62% |
Housing with automobile: | 8.64% | 4.05% |
Households with personal computer, laptop or tablet: | 3.70% | 0.00% |
Homes with landline telephone: | 0.00% | 1.35% |
Dwellings with cellular phones: | 59.26% | 6.76% |
Homes with Internet: | 13.58% | 0.00% |
